Casemiro Dropped by Brazil for Copa America

Brazil have left Manchester United midfielder, Casemiro out of their squad for this summer’s Copa America.

The 32-year-old has endured a poor season and had a particularly tough night in Monday’s embarrassing defeat at Crystal Palace, which led to Sky Sports’ Jamie Carragher believing “football has left him”.

The ex-Real Madrid man, who was named Brazil’s captain in March last year, is one of a number of Premier League players to miss out on the Copa America squad.

Tottenham forward Richarlison, Arsenal forward Gabriel Jesus and Wolves striker Matheus Cunha are all absent from manager Dorival Junior’s first squad for a major tournament.

There are, however, nine Premier League players in the 23-man squad, including Fulham midfielder Andreas Pereira, Wolves’ Joao Gomes and Arsenal attacker Gabriel Martinelli.
